A PostCSS plugin for managing consistent scale, proportion and vertical rhythm using custom units based on numerical sequences.
Create custom units by defining an abbreviation and the pattern to generate the nth index from a numerical sequence.
units: [
{
abbr: 'gu',
pattern: 'n * 4',
}
]
Example:
div {
padding: 4gu;
}
Outputs:
div {
padding: 16px;
}
npm install postcss-sequence --save-dev
Define one or more units by passing them to the plugin as options:
units: [
{
abbr: 'gu',
pattern: 'n * 4',
}
]
Key | Description |
---|---|
abbr |
A string with the abbreviation of the name for your unit. For more complex units you can use a number identifier like so <g> where g is the variable used in your pattern. If you require something unique you can also use a regex . |
position |
Position of where the abbreviation is placed. To the end by default. Choose from 'start' , 'middle' or 'end' . |
pattern |
Pattern used to generate the n index from a numerical sequence. If using a regex or middle position affix you can use lowercase letters starting from a to reference groups in in the order they were captured. See example below. |
output |
Optional,'px' used by default. |
A grid unit based on a grid of 4px
units: [
{
abbr: 'gu',
pattern: 'n * 4',
}
]
Example:
div {
padding: 4gu;
margin: 4gu 2gu;
}
Outputs:
div {
padding: 16px;
margin: 16px 8px;
}
Setting the font based on a scale using golden ratio.
units: [
{
abbr: 'x',
pattern: 'round (16 * 1.618 ^ n) / 16',
output: 'rem'
}
]
Example:
h1 {
font-size: 4x;
}
h2 {
font-size: 3x;
}
h3 {
font-size: 2x;
}
Output:
h1 {
font-size: 6.875rem;
}
h2 {
font-size: 4.25rem;
}
h3 {
font-size: 2.625rem;
}
Writing in feet and inches.
units: [
{
abbr: /([0-9]+)\'([0-9]+)\"/,
pattern: '((a * 12) + b ) * 10',
output: 'px'
}
]
Example:
div {
width: 4'2";
}
Outputs:
div {
width: 500px;
}
Using fractions for percentages.
units: [
{
abbr: '<n>/<d>',
pattern: 'n / d',
output: '%'
}
]
Example:
div {
width: 1/4;
}
Outputs:
div {
width: 25%;
}
Automatically round pixels to the nearest ten pixels.
units: [
{
abbr: 'px',
pattern: 'round (n / 10) * 10'
}]
Example:
div {
width: 26px;
}
Outputs:
div {
width: 30px;
}
